    Triviality arguments against functionalism
    Philosophical Studies 145 (2). 2009.
    “Triviality arguments” against functionalism in the philosophy of mind hold that the claim that some complex physical system exhibits a given functional organization is either trivial or has much less content than is usually supposed. I survey several earlier arguments of this kind, and present a new one that overcomes some limitations in the earlier arguments.   •  585
    Recurrent transient underdetermination and the glass half full (review)
    Philosophical Studies 137 (1). 2008.
    Kyle Stanford’s arguments against scientific realism are assessed, with a focus on the underdetermination of theory by evidence. I argue that discussions of underdetermination have neglected a possible symmetry which may ameliorate the situation.

    Reply to Rosenberg
    Biology and Philosophy 33 (3-4): 19. 2018.
    I respond to two of the main arguments in Rosenberg’s commentary on “Mind, Matter, and Metabolism.” Rosenberg’s claim that metabolic activities are “modularized” in a way that sets them apart from cognitive processes is not true given the broad sense of the “metabolic” employed in my paper, and contemporary neuroscience, including the work on navigation cited by Rosenberg, has begun to yield an understanding of subjectivity and “point of view.”

    Is it a revolution?
    Biology and Philosophy 22 (3): 429-437. 2007.
    Jablonka and Lamb's claim that evolutionary biology is undergoing a ‘revolution’ is queried. But the very concept of revolutionary change has uncertain application to a field organized in the manner of contemporary biology. The explanatory primacy of sequence properties is also discussed.

    Indication and adaptation
    Synthese 92 (2): 283-312. 1992.
    This paper examines the relationship between a family of concepts involving reliable correlation, and a family of concepts involving adaptation and biological function, as these concepts are used in the naturalistic semantic theory of Dretske's "Explaining Behavior." I argue that Dretske's attempt to marry correlation and function to produce representation fails, though aspects of his failure point the way forward to a better theory.

    Gradualism and the Evolution of Experience
    Philosophical Topics 48 (1): 201-220. 2020.
    In evolution, large-scale changes that involve the origin of complex new traits occur gradually, in a broad sense of the term. This principle applies to the origin of subjective or felt experience. I respond to difficulties that have been raised for a gradualist view in this area, and sketch a scenario for the gradual evolution of subjective experience, drawing on recent research into early nervous system evolution.

    Dewey on naturalism, realism and science
    Proceedings of the Philosophy of Science Association 2002 (3). 2002.
    An interpretation of John Dewey’s views about realism, science, and naturalistic philosophy is presented. Dewey should be seen as an unorthodox realist, with respect to both general metaphysical debates about realism and with respect to debates about the aims and achievements of science.
